Post by Templar Knight on Nov 23, 2018 19:08:49 GMT
Not sure if this is the right place for this, but I'm in a little bit of a pickle with the Scrolls of Banastor sidequest on my current playthrough. Namely, while I've gotten all five scrolls, the last three didn't update my codex, and the Mages' Collective liaisons aren't reacting to them. I am using Qwinn's Fixpack this time around - my first time using a mod - and wonder if that might have broken something. I know Qwinn's pack does something with the Scrolls (apparently makes them "disappear from your plot items after completing the quest"). In my case, however, I find myself unable to complete the quest at all. Is anyone familiar with this problem?

Post by EZClap on Jan 29, 2019 5:53:05 GMT
I dunno if doing it like this causes bugs but Run this in the console runscript zz_getsetplotflag set lite_mage_banastor 2 1 That'll advance the quest If you want the codex entries then runscript zz_getsetplotflag set cod_lite_tow_banastor 0 1 runscript zz_getsetplotflag set cod_lite_tow_banastor 1 1 runscript zz_getsetplotflag set cod_lite_tow_banastor 2 1 runscript zz_getsetplotflag set cod_lite_tow_banastor 3 1 runscript zz_getsetplotflag set cod_lite_tow_banastor 4 1

Post by Qwinn on Feb 3, 2019 20:26:25 GMT
Hullo all. I've had this reported on my posts page and I'm working on version 3.5 of the Fixpack now, and found this thread while working the problem. Unfortunately I can't reproduce it, nor can I see from the code how I (or anything) could be causing it. I don't change anything about this particular quest. My removing the scrolls at the end of the quest couldn't have any impact on it at all, since the problem you're having is that you *can't* complete the quest, and your scrolls aren't being removed. I've posted my findings so far in detail on the posts page of the mod on Nexus. Since I can't reproduce it, I'll need someone who has a save game where the bug can be made to recur to answer my questions. Thanks for any help you guys can provide.
BTW, uninstalling my mod midgame is absolutely sure to break your game, and unlikely to fix any bug it could cause regardless. If you want to do it as a test anyway, go for it, but don't bother saving any game after you do that, and revert to a previous save afterwards.
